Remodeling your pool is a custom project, so final costs depend heavily on the specific upgrades you select. Replacing simple pool tiles or updating your plaster is generally more affordable than installing entirely new decking, lighting systems, or automation features. The physical size of your pool and the current condition of the plumbing underneath also play a major role in the total bill. Pool maintenance is the ongoing process of balancing chemicals, cleaning surfaces, and inspecting equipment to ensure your pool remains swimmable. You need regular maintenance to protect your investment and extend the life of your pump and filter. Tasks include skimming, brushing, and managing water chemistry levels.
